더북(TheBook)

리베이스를 할 수 있게 description 브랜치로 체크아웃하겠습니다.

 

infoh@DESKTOP MINGW64 /e/gitstudy08 (master)

$ git checkout description 리베이스 브랜치

Switched to branch 'description'

 

infoh@DESKTOP MINGW64 /e/gitstudy08 (description)

description 브랜치에서 원본 master 브랜치를 리베이스합니다.

infoh@DESKTOP MINGW64 /e/gitstudy08 (description)

$ git rebase master master 브랜치를 리베이스

First, rewinding head to replay your work on top of it...

Applying: add description

리베이스 명령이 실행되면 파생 브랜치의 커밋들은 기준 브랜치의 마지막 커밋으로 재정렬됩니다. 소스트리에서 결과를 확인해 봅시다.

▼ 그림 8-41 리베이스 결과

0840.jpg

master 브랜치의 마지막 커밋 ‘add menu6’ 뒤에 파생 브랜치의 커밋이 연결된 것을 볼 수 있습니다. 두 브랜치를 하나의 그래프 모양으로 합친 형태입니다.

신간 소식 구독하기
뉴스레터에 가입하시고 이메일로 신간 소식을 받아 보세요.